Kobyla Góra is the highest elevation in Wielkopolska (284 m above sea level), located in the Ostrzeszów Hills range. At its peak there is the Greater Poland Jubilee Cross, commemorative stones and the John Paul II Bell, which tolls daily at 3:00 p.m. This place serves an important pilgrimage and sightseeing function, offering distant views, including the Eastern Sudetes and the Opole Power Plant. Several hiking and cycling trails lead to the peak, including the Trans-Greater Poland Cycling Route.

A great tourist and recreational showcase of the region and an attractive place for lovers of outdoor recreation. A sandy, 300-meter beach allows for pleasant sunbathing. From the separate guarded bathing area there is a gentle descent to the water and children can safely splash around under the watchful eye of parents and lifeguards. During the holiday season, catering points and a water equipment rental (kayaks, water bikes) are open. For those who like to relax close to nature, staying overnight at a campsite - right by the beach - can be a great pleasure. Do you need activity? On the reservoir there are beach volleyball courts, football and basketball courts, two boules tracks, a rope playground for children with a sandbox and plenty of space for other beach games. There are also great conditions for sailing, windsurfing and fishing.

Bralin offers over 15 mountain bike trails, catering to various skill levels. The network includes a mix of easy, moderate, and some more challenging routes.
The trails in Bralin are predominantly easy and moderate. There are 6 easy routes, 9 moderate routes, and 1 difficult route available for mountain biking.
Yes, Bralin has several easy mountain bike trails perfect for beginners. A popular choice is the Stradomia Reservoir Beach loop from Syców, which is 12.6 miles (20.3 km) long and circles the reservoir, offering pleasant views.
You can expect a varied landscape featuring forests, open fields, and trails alongside reservoirs. The terrain generally includes gently rolling hills with moderate elevation gains, providing a mix of natural surfaces.
Many of the mountain bike routes in Bralin are designed as loops. Examples include the Mountainbike loop from gmina Ostrzeszów and the Abandoned Bunker in the Forest – Fragments of the Berlin Wall loop from Syców, allowing you to start and end at the same point.
While riding, you might encounter historical elements like the 'Fragments of the Berlin Wall' on the Abandoned Bunker in the Forest loop. Nearby attractions include the Church of the Nativity of the Blessed Virgin Mary in Myślniew and the Krzyż Wielkopolski on Kobyla Góra.
Yes, the Stradomia Reservoir Beach loop from Syców circles the Stradomia Reservoir, offering scenic views of the water and surrounding natural areas.

Yes, for longer rides, consider routes like the Mountainbike loop from Syców, which covers over 31 miles (50 km) with significant elevation gain, or the Abandoned Bunker in the Forest – Fragments of the Berlin Wall loop at 29 miles (46.7 km).
While specific parking areas are not detailed for every trail, routes often start from towns like Syców or gmina Ostrzeszów, where public parking options may be available. It is advisable to check local parking information for your chosen starting point.
The best time for mountain biking in Bralin generally aligns with spring, summer, and early autumn when the weather is mild and trails are dry. These seasons offer the most comfortable conditions for exploring the region's forests and open landscapes.
